Club 365
North Lanarkshire’s leading holiday programme, which provides free meals for pupils during the holidays, has been expanded to include weekends.
Club 365 will now open in eight venues every weekend and in 23 venues throughout school holidays as part of the council’s drive to tackle weekend and holiday hunger.
Primary school pupils who qualify for free school meals can come along from 11.30am to 1.30pm and enjoy a hot lunch, sports and activities in a fun setting.
Sessions to date have been well attended, making a big difference to the lives of families in low income households and children really enjoyed taking part in the activities on offer.
Weekend venue – Old Monkland Primary.
